Parkers

The Porsche Macan (2014 - 2024) is praised for its exceptional handling and performance, with a sporty feel that rivals smaller sports cars. It's also admired for its luxurious interior, packed with high-quality materials and technology. However, some critiques note that rear passenger space could be tight, and the ride can be firm over rough surfaces.

Read full review
Autocar

AutoCar highlights the Macan's striking design and impressive build quality, making it a desirable option in the compact SUV market. The interior provides a premium feel with advanced technologies. However, the price is seen as steep, and fuel economy is not its strongest suit.

Read full review
WhatCar

WhatCar rates the Porsche Macan highly for reliability, noting its well-engineered components and minimal owner complaints. Nevertheless, service costs and parts can be expensive, which is a common worry among potential buyers of luxury vehicles.

The Porsche Macan was created to combine sports car performance with the practicality of an SUV, targeting drivers who seek versatility without compromising on the driving experience. Since its launch in 2014, the Macan has evolved through continuous enhancements in technology, comfort, and performance, with recent strides towards embracing electric propulsion, representing Porsche's commitment to both tradition and innovation.

Compare with alternatives

The Porsche Macan (2014 - 2024) stands out in its price range for its sporty performance and luxury appeal, closely competing with premium SUVs like the Audi Q5, BMW X3, and Mercedes-Benz GLC.

Audi Q5

Reference only

Positioned as a luxury compact SUV, balancing comfort and performance, and popular for its premium features.

vs features
The Q5 offers a refined cabin and a smooth ride, matching the Macan in luxury but favoring comfort over sporty handling. Audi's MMI infotainment system generally rivals Porsche's infotainment in terms of user-friendliness.
vs price
Typically less expensive than the Macan, with prices reflecting its slightly lower badge prestige while offering similar luxury features.

BMW X3

Reference only

A well-rounded luxury compact SUV known for its sporty driving dynamics and practicality.

vs features
The X3 emphasizes driving enjoyment, with sharp handling compared to the Macan's more performance-focused setup. Tech features are comparable, but cabin materials may lack the premium feel of the Macan.
vs price
Price is often aligned with the Macan, but options can increase costs significantly, making it sometimes more expensive depending on specifications.

Mercedes-Benz GLC

Reference only

Targets buyers seeking a luxury SUV experience with emphasis on comfort and advanced technology.

vs features
The GLC offers a plush ride quality and advanced driver-assistance features, focusing more on comfort than sportiness, unlike the Macan, which emphasizes agility and responsiveness.
vs price
Generally priced similar to the Macan, though higher trims and options can push costs higher.
